Henny

HEN-ee

Henny is a girl’s name of Germanic origin, meaning “A diminutive of the Germanic name Henrietta, meaning 'ruler of the home' or 'home ruler'. It suggests leadership and strength.”. It currently ranks #2977 in the US, and peaked in popularity in 2021.

The Story of Henny

A name suggesting command of hearth and home, Henny carries a quiet strength, an inheritance of leadership for your little ruler.

Henny is a charming diminutive of the Germanic name Henrietta, which itself is derived from Henry. The name carries the meaning 'ruler of the home' or 'home ruler,' suggesting a position of authority and care within the domestic sphere. It gained traction in the late 19th and early 20th centuries, a name chosen for its blend of familiarity and a hint of matriarchal strength.
